How much do operation coordinator j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 15, 2026, the average hourly pay for operation coordinator in Rochester, NY is $23.97,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$19.09 and $26.97 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an operation coordinator do?

An Operation Coordinator is responsible for overseeing and streamlining the daily operations of a business or organization. Their duties typically include coordinating schedules, managing communication between departments, ensuring compliance with company policies, and supporting logistical needs. They play a key role in problem-solving and improving efficiency, working closely with managers and staff to ensure that organizational goals are met. Operation Coordinators are essential in keeping projects on track and maintaining smooth workflows.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an operation coordinator,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Operation Coordinator,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a background in business administration or a related field. Familiarity with project management software, scheduling tools, and office productivity systems is typically required.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and adaptability help you stand out in this role. These skills and qualities ensure efficient workflow, timely execution of tasks, and effective collaboration across departments.

How much do operation coordinators make in the US?

Operation coordinators in the US typically earn a median annual salary of around $50,000 to $65,000, depending on experience, industry, and location. Salaries can vary based on the complexity of operations managed and the level of responsibility involved.

What are some common challenges operation coordinators face when managing multiple projects simultaneously?

Operation Coordinators often juggle several projects at once, which can make prioritization and time management challenging. Balancing urgent tasks, aligning with different teams, and ensuring timely communication require strong organizational skills and adaptability. Effective coordinators develop systems for tracking progress, delegate appropriately, and proactively address bottlenecks to keep operations running smoothly. Regular check-ins with stakeholders and clear documentation also help minimize misunderstandings and delays.

Operations Coordinator
Part-Time - Job Share
Position: Operations Coordinator (Part-Time)
Schedule: Monday, Wednesday & Friday - approximately 24 hours per week
Job Share: This position is part of a job-sharing arrangement with an Office Manager who works Tuesday and Thursday.
Position Summary
Locally owned home care agency dedicated to helping seniors remain safe in their homes is looking for a compassionate, organized professional with a genuine desire to help seniors, families, and caregivers.
The Operations Coordinator plays an important role in supporting the day-to-day operations of our home care agency. This position is responsible for coordinating caregiver schedules, communicating with clients, families, and caregivers, answering incoming calls, providing administrative support and will work closely with the Tuesday/Thursday Office Manager to ensure seamless communication, continuity of client care, accurate scheduling, and efficient office operations throughout the week.
Why This Position May Be a Great Fit
Consistent Part-Time Schedule & Work-Life Balance
This position offers a consistent Monday, Wednesday, and Friday schedule, making it an excellent opportunity for someone who enjoys working with people, staying organized, solving problems, flexibility, and being part of a supportive, locally owned company who values teamwork and work-life balance.
Key Responsibilities
Client & Family Relations
  • Serve as a primary point of contact for clients and their families.
  • Answer incoming telephone calls and respond to client inquiries in a professional and timely manner.
  • Coordinate client service requests and scheduling changes.
  • Maintain positive client and family relationships through excellent customer service.
  • Communicate important updates and concerns to management as appropriate.

Scheduling & Staffing
  • Coordinate caregiver schedules and client assignments.
  • Fill open shifts and respond to caregiver call-offs.
  • Communicate schedule changes to clients and caregivers.
  • Monitor caregiver availability and staffing needs.
  • Help ensure that clients receive consistent and reliable caregiver coverage.

Office Administration
  • Maintain accurate client and caregiver records.
  • Process agency documentation and correspondence.
  • Assist with long-term care insurance forms and administrative paperwork.
  • Monitor and respond to office email and voicemail.
  • Provide general administrative support and help maintain an organized office environment.

Quality Assurance & Client Support
  • Conduct client satisfaction follow-up calls.
  • Document client concerns and communicate them to management.
  • Assist with resolving scheduling and service-related issues promptly.
  • Help identify potential problems before they affect the client or caregiver experience.

Job-Share Responsibilities
Because this position is shared with an Office Manager, communication and organization between the two coordinators are essential.
Both Operations Coordinators and the Office Manager are expected to:
  • Maintain clear and detailed notes regarding outstanding client, caregiver, and scheduling issues.
  • Update scheduling systems and client records before the end of each workday.
  • Clearly communicate unresolved matters to the coordinator working the next scheduled day.
  • Review emails, phone messages, and schedule changes from the previous workday at the beginning of each shift.
  • Keep each other informed of important client or caregiver developments.
  • Work cooperatively to provide consistent service and minimize disruptions for clients and caregivers.
